Web19 jan. 2024 · 4. Contract your abs as you move through the squat. Pull in your abs, and keep your lower back in a nearly neutral position. To keep your abs braced and contracted, keep your back as straight as possible in a neutral alignment. For most people, this means that there may be a slight curve in the lower back. Web9 sep. 2024 · ATG squats are a type of very deep squat in which you lower your hips as far down as possible, surpassing parallel. Other than the depth, the form is pretty much the same as your conventional squat. Everyone’s ATG depth is different as you should aim for a depth that is your personal maximum possible depth. When you squat for muscle endurance, keep the resistance less than 50% of your one-rep max. Using this resistance should allow you to do 15 to 20 reps before fatiguing.
